What's The Definition Of Deckle?
deckle in American English
a removable wooden frame used as an edging for the four sides of a sheet mold in making paper by hand noun: a board, usually of stainless steel, fitted under part of the wire in a Fourdrinier machine for supporting the pulp stack before it is sufficiently formed to support itself on the wire deckle in British English noun: a frame used to contain pulp on the mould in the making of handmade paper |
